Transaction 59e9401cf9aba17723f900bcc4bc0b31c9be68a9c44e77006277b41cde2ec254

1 Input
2 Outputs
  • 59e9401cf9aba17723f900bcc4bc0b31c9be68a9c44e77006277b41cde2ec254:0
  • value  8583
    address  3BgETtacxwSCWtsD5zY3sXgZCNXS3n5mkV
  • 59e9401cf9aba17723f900bcc4bc0b31c9be68a9c44e77006277b41cde2ec254:1
  • value  528320
    address  12bRYMDWFFzbKo8NuCFkWCVE8TwBZMtEiD